Webb27 mars 2024 · Grade 1: The least severe form of concussion, when the individual’s brain functions return to normalcy after 15 minutes. Grade 2: When the brain malfunctions and the person is confused for more than 15 minutes. Grade 3: When the impact is so severe that the person becomes unconscious.
